New Species of Spiny Lobster Discovered

Cape Town South Africa’s marine scientists have just discovered a new species of giant spiny lobster. Although the genetics of the lobster show that it is a new species, scientists say it may already have been exploited to the brink of extinction by fishermen mistaking it for another species of spiny lobster. The lobster that was caught weighed in at a massive 9 lbs and was the third new species of lobster discovered in the last 12 years. The new species has been named Palinurus barbarae in honor of the discoverer’s wife Barbra who was a math teacher, and died of cancer at age 30. “I’m very glad that I could name it after her. She was a brave and beautiful woman” He said.
